Job Description


Full time 2nd Shift M-F 3pm- 11pm 26.50 /hr Starting pay Responsible for the general maintenance and troubleshooting of the facility's terminals, computers, monitors, printers/copiers, Radio Frequency (RF) handheld devices and telephones. Responsibilities also entail knowledge in preventative maintenance procedures, troubleshooting guidelines, work requests documentation, spare parts procurement, and inventory control of assets mentioned above.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S• Meet department deadlines. Maintain follow up and follow through• Answer calls and pages professionally and courteously. Complete requests in a timely manner• You should be comfortable working in a warehouse environment, which includes seasonal temperature changes, rolling equipment, and conveyors• Willingness and ability to learn new software, testing procedures, systems and/or requirements deployed in our DC Operations• Troubleshoot and train others on new software, systems, or additions to CVS operations• React to emergency situations and prioritize work requirements• Interact professionally with outside vendors, Management, and Corporate• Ability to converse and relay technical information via e-mail• Read, comprehend, and interpret technical reference manuals• Maintain all service provisions for both DCs: WDC & NSDC

Required Qualifications


Familiarity working in a MDF and IDF rooms• Intermediate computer components knowledge• Familiarity with different Internet browsers such as Chrome, Edge• Ability to set up and configure computers, including mapping of shared drives, installing printers, and setting up desktop shortcuts• Familiarity with MS Office 365 applications• Good working knowledge of MS Access database a plus• Ability to learn quickly and be able to troubleshoot and adapt to a variety of technical situations• Professional telephone etiquette• Good written and verbal communication skills• Knowledge of basic mathematics• Flexibility to work overtime in short notice situations or as needed• Ability to work any shift, any day of the week as needed• Ability to cross-train in the Data Room, and any other function deemed necessary in the Department• Ability to flex schedule for coverage to any shift. Ability to work OT as required, including Saturday and Sunday• Willingness to attend classes or training in computer software/hardware• Willingness to learn the conveyor system software (WCS) and ability to troubleshootMARGINAL FUNCTIONS• Maintain the Computer Room and all equipment therein in a clean, safe, and orderly condition. Maintain first level cleanliness in keeping product free from trash and dust• Greet vendors/contractors at Lobby areas and escort to location where services are to be performed• Perform other duties as requested by Manager• Ability to cross-train and perform to standard in various functions as required by management
